Output 33c4bf0c966f7488bf72662d67566a0d3344676effba3bae05226005a136fae7:20

value
22988892
script pubkey
OP_0 OP_PUSHBYTES_20 7c6f273d8426b4922f20a31b8be71d70d18993cc
address
bc1q03hjw0vyy66fyteq5vdchecawrgcny7vmjsh9s
transaction
33c4bf0c966f7488bf72662d67566a0d3344676effba3bae05226005a136fae7
spent
true